excel村组怎么排序

excel村组怎么排序

Excel村组排序的方法有多种:使用排序功能、利用筛选功能、通过公式进行排序、使用宏来自动排序。在本文中,我们将详细讲解每种方法,并提供具体的步骤和技巧,帮助你在Excel中更高效地进行村组排序。

一、使用排序功能

使用Excel的内置排序功能是最常见且简单的方法之一。你可以通过以下步骤轻松实现村组排序:

  1. 选择数据范围:首先,选中你要排序的整个数据范围,包括村组名称和其他相关信息。

  2. 打开排序对话框:在Excel的菜单栏中,点击“数据”选项卡,然后选择“排序”按钮。你将看到一个对话框,允许你根据不同的列进行排序。

  3. 设置排序条件:在对话框中,你可以选择要排序的列(例如村组名称),并指定是升序还是降序排序。如果你的数据包含标题行,请确保勾选“我的数据有标题”。

  4. 应用排序:点击“确定”按钮,Excel将根据你设置的条件对数据进行排序。

详细描述:设置排序条件

在设置排序条件时,选择正确的排序列和排序顺序是至关重要的。比如,如果你的数据包含多个村组名称,你可以选择按村组名称列进行升序排序,以便按字母顺序排列所有村组。这不仅有助于更容易地查找特定的村组,还能让数据在视觉上更加整齐和有序。

二、利用筛选功能

除了排序功能,Excel的筛选功能也可以用于村组排序,尤其当你需要对数据进行多条件筛选时。

  1. 启用筛选:选择数据范围,然后在“数据”选项卡中点击“筛选”按钮。Excel会在每个列标题上添加一个下拉箭头。

  2. 应用筛选条件:点击村组名称列标题上的下拉箭头,选择“排序A到Z”或“排序Z到A”。你还可以选择特定的村组进行筛选,以仅显示相关数据。

  3. 组合筛选条件:如果你的数据包含多个条件(例如年份、类型等),你可以在其他列上应用其他筛选条件,以进一步细化结果。

三、通过公式进行排序

在一些复杂的场景中,你可能需要使用公式来进行更高级的排序操作。以下是一些常用的公式方法:

  1. 使用RANK函数:RANK函数可以根据特定列的值对数据进行排名,然后你可以根据排名列进行排序。

  2. 使用SORT函数:Excel 365和Excel 2019中新增的SORT函数可以直接对数据进行排序。你只需指定数据范围和排序列,函数会自动返回排序结果。

示例:使用SORT函数

假设你的村组数据在A2:B10范围内,村组名称在A列,你可以使用以下公式进行升序排序:

=SORT(A2:B10, 1, 1)

该公式会按A列(村组名称)进行升序排序,并返回排序后的数据。

四、使用宏来自动排序

如果你需要经常对村组数据进行排序,使用宏来自动化这个过程会大大提高效率。以下是一个简单的宏示例:

  1. 打开VBA编辑器:按“Alt + F11”打开VBA编辑器。

  2. 插入新模块:点击“插入”菜单,选择“模块”。

  3. 输入宏代码:在模块中输入以下代码:

Sub SortVillageData()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1") '修改为你的工作表名称

ws.Range("A1:B10").Sort Key1:=ws.Range("A1"), Order1:=xlAscending, Header:=xlYes

End Sub

  1. 运行宏:关闭VBA编辑器,返回Excel,按“Alt + F8”打开宏运行对话框,选择“SortVillageData”宏并点击“运行”。

详细描述:设置宏代码

在宏代码中,你需要指定数据范围和排序列。上面的示例代码中,我们将A1:B10范围内的数据按A列(村组名称)进行升序排序。如果你的数据范围或工作表名称不同,请根据实际情况进行修改。

五、使用数据透视表

数据透视表是Excel中的强大工具,能够帮助你快速汇总和分析数据。你也可以利用数据透视表来对村组数据进行排序。

  1. 创建数据透视表:选择数据范围,然后在“插入”选项卡中点击“数据透视表”按钮。

  2. 设置数据透视表字段:在数据透视表字段列表中,将村组名称拖动到行标签区域,将其他相关数据拖动到数值区域。

  3. 应用排序:右键点击村组名称列中的任意单元格,选择“排序”,然后选择“升序”或“降序”。

六、总结

通过本文,你已经了解了多种在Excel中对村组数据进行排序的方法,包括使用排序功能、利用筛选功能、通过公式进行排序、使用宏来自动排序以及使用数据透视表。每种方法都有其独特的优势和适用场景,你可以根据实际需求选择最合适的方法。

核心重点内容

  • 使用排序功能:最常见且简单的方法。
  • 利用筛选功能:适用于多条件筛选。
  • 通过公式进行排序:适用于复杂排序需求。
  • 使用宏来自动排序:适用于频繁排序操作。
  • 使用数据透视表:强大的数据汇总和分析工具。

希望这些方法能够帮助你更高效地在Excel中对村组数据进行排序,提高工作效率。

相关问答FAQs:

1. Excel村组排序有哪些方法?

  • 按照某一列的数值大小进行排序: 在Excel中,你可以选择要排序的数据列,然后使用排序功能按照升序或降序排列。
  • 按照字母顺序对村组进行排序: 如果你的村组名称都是以字母开头的,你可以使用Excel的排序功能按照字母顺序对村组进行排序。
  • 按照自定义的排序规则进行排序: 如果你想按照自己设定的排序规则对村组进行排序,你可以使用Excel的自定义排序功能来实现。

2. 如何在Excel中按照村组名称进行升序排序?

  • 首先,选择包含村组名称的列。
  • 其次,在Excel的菜单栏中选择“数据”选项卡。
  • 然后,点击“排序”按钮,在弹出的排序对话框中选择要排序的列和排序顺序(升序)。
  • 最后,点击“确定”按钮完成排序。

3. 如何在Excel中按照村组名称进行降序排序?

  • 首先,选择包含村组名称的列。
  • 其次,在Excel的菜单栏中选择“数据”选项卡。
  • 然后,点击“排序”按钮,在弹出的排序对话框中选择要排序的列和排序顺序(降序)。
  • 最后,点击“确定”按钮完成排序。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4596683

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部